Once you get over the 80s lycra-clad bodies and super-tight hot-shorts in fluoro colours, it is a really good workout. Those are really the only things that age this workout as the moves are terriffic! None would be out of place now and this DVD makes a nice change for someone who works out to Les Mills Pump as there are enough exercises with weights/dumbells to push your muscles and similar muscle groups are used.When the difficulty level rose, I also stopped being distracted by Tracie's pnumatic chest enhancements and marvelous steroid-built-looking leg muscles to concentrate on the moves which were sometimes complicated.A few times I reverted to what I thought they were doing or whatever the previous steps were because it just became to complex for a chorographically-challenged person like me. Maybe with more practice and pausing, I'll get them right. You need lots of floor space to complete this challenging hour also.I don't have much space so I had to keep pausing to rearrange equipment and when I resumed, my heart rate had obviously dropped and I had lost a bit of momentum. You really need a high step or the proper 'Fanny Lifter' to do several sections as a step platform (which is all I had) is too low. You won't be getting as much out of those sections either because the ordinary step is lower. I didn't like the terms 'medium to heavy weights/light to medium weights', I would rather have them use exact kilogram/pound amounts. I got a little confused when they swapped weights and didn't know which ones to use for what, but again that would improve with multiple playing of this DVD.The music is surprisingly OK and not irritating (with classical for the stretches at the end); the background decor is lovely (like Italianite & marble) and it looks like a lot more effort & thought went in to making these The Firm exercise series than the more recent ones.I'd definitely workout to this again. My muscles really felt the strain of using the weights towards the end of the reps and especially with the second round of reps and it seemed like ~50 minutes well spent (although I'd rather 30 minutes for a challenging weights DVD). The floor work for abs was also great, and plenty of pushups during the workout made this a well-rounded, fairly high-intensity sculpt class.The cover does say beginner to intermediate, but since I've been familiar with both gym and home DVD workouts for several years and still found this complicated, I'd hesitate to recommend it to absolute beginners.
